Kesh-xotirani tashkil etish usullari

Ushbu kitob kesh xotira, mikroprotsessorlar va operativ xotira o'rtasidagi o'zaro aloqalarni o'rganishga bag'ishlangan. Unda kesh xotiraning tuzilishi, ishlash prinsiplari, tashkil etish usullari va samaradorligini oshirish yo'llari ko'rib chiqiladi. Ko'p protsessorli tizimlarda kesh xotiraning ahamiyati, xotira ierarxiyasi va kesh-xotira protokollari ham tahlil qilingan.

Asosiy mavzular

  • Kesh xotirani tashkil qilish usullari: Kesh xotirani to'g'ridan-to'g'ri aks ettirish, to'liq assotsiativ va ko'p assotsiativ usullari orqali tashkil etish, blokning kesh-xotirada joylashishi va kerakli blokni topish usullari, xatolikda blokni almashtirish strategiyalari (tasodifiy va LRU), yozish jarayoni va kesh-xotira samaradorligini oshirish formulasi.
  • Ko'p protsessorli tizimlarda kesh-xotira: Ko'p protsessorli tizimlarda kesh-xotira va operativ xotiraning mutanosib ishlashi, kesh xotira bilan sahifa darajasida boshqaruv, mikroprotsessor kesh xotirasining aloqa ta'minoti va kesh-xotira protokollari (directory based va snooping protokollari).
  • MESI protokoli: MESI protokoli mikroprotsessor kesh-xotirasi qatorining holatini (Modified, Exclusive, Shared, Invalid) akslantirish, holat alomatlari va protsessorning ishlash jarayonida xotira aloqasini ta'minlash vaziyatlari.
  • Kesh-xotira samaradorligini oshirish: Kesh-xotirali tizimlarda xotiraga murojaat vaqtini qisqartirish, xatolik ulushlarini kamaytirish va kesh-xotira samaradorligini oshirish formulasi.